Mixed surfactant systems are preferred over the simple surfactants because of their enhanced surface activity. Surfactants endowed with structural similarity in their hydrophobic portions are most often used in such studies. The hydrolysis of N-Acetyl Benzo- hydroxamic acid is of considerable importance both chemically as well as biochemically. Organized molecular aggregates viz. micelles and micro emulsions have been used as attractive reaction media for studying the reactivity and the catalytic activity of a number of chemical as well as bio-chemical interactions.In the present communication, we will studies the hydrolysis of N-Acetyl Benzo-Hydroxamic Acid (ABHA) in 10 % (v/v) Dioxane- water medium in 0.87M HCl in the presence of non-ionic micelles of polyoxyethylene and laurylether and cationic micelles of cetyl trimethyl ammonium bromide (CTAB, C16H33N+Me3Br-) and cetyl pyridinium bromide (CPB, C16H33H+C5H5Br-). The investigation revealed that the hydrolysis of ABHA in acidic medium is first order with respect to substrate. The identification of the product of hydrolysis supported the proposed mechanism.

We synthesised C-(2-Hydroxyphenyl)-N-phenyl nitrone and its N-phenyl derivatives (la-Va) by condensing salicylaldehyde with phenylhydroxylamines (I-V). The reduction of nitrones (la-Va) with sodium borohydride results in the formation of Schiff bases (lb-Vb). The products were characterised using elemental analysis and spectral analysis, and their antifungal activity against Alternaria alternata, Fusarium oxysporum, Myrothecium roridum, and Ustilago tritici was determined in vitro using the spore germination inhibition technique. Nitrones had superior antifungal activity against M. roridum and A. alternata, but Schiff bases shown superior fungitoxicity against U. trifici.
